Casa Del Sol Scottsdale, LLC offers competitive pricing for its accommodations compared to the broader market in Maricopa County and the state of Arizona. The monthly cost for a semi-private room at Casa Del Sol is $1,800, which is significantly lower than the county average of $2,801 and the state average of $2,820. Similarly, their private rooms are priced at $2,400, offering a more affordable option than both the county average of $3,318 and the state average of $3,345. Casa Del Sol Scottsdale, LLC is an assisted living community located in Scottsdale, AZ. Our focus is on providing exceptional care for individuals with memory care needs.
We offer a range of amenities to ensure our residents' comfort and enjoyment. Our on-site activities provide opportunities for socialization and engagement, while our indoor and outdoor common areas allow for relaxation and recreation. For those looking to stay active, we have a swimming pool and hot tub available. Our facility is also wheelchair accessible with wheelchair accessible showers.
Our care services are designed to meet the specific needs of our residents. We provide high acuity care for those requiring specialized attention, as well as incontinence care and medication management.
Dining at Casa Del Sol Scottsdale is a culinary experience with options that cater to various dietary preferences and restrictions. Our menu includes international cuisine, low/no sodium options, organic meals, vegetarian choices, and no sugar added dishes. Guests are welcome to join for meals as well.
At Casa Del Sol Scottsdale, we believe in keeping our residents engaged and entertained through a variety of activities. These include birthday parties, devotional activities both on-site and off-site, light therapy programs, live dance or theater performances, live musical performances, reminiscence programs, stretching classes, and yoga or chair yoga sessions.

Casa Del Sol Scottsdale, LLC's medication management ensures that residents receive their prescribed medications accurately and on time, which is crucial for maintaining cognitive function and overall health in individuals with dementia or Alzheimer's disease. By closely monitoring dosages and schedules, staff can help prevent potential complications or adverse reactions associated with missed or incorrect medications. Additionally, incontinence care is tailored to the unique needs of each resident, providing dignity and comfort while addressing this common issue among those with memory impairments. This compassionate approach not only alleviates physical discomfort but also promotes emotional well-being by reducing anxiety related to incontinence, allowing residents to focus on their daily activities and social interactions within a supportive environment.
